Special ingredient at Swiss Restaurant? Breast Milk!

Posted by SunnyChanel

We all know about the benefits of breast milk for our babies, but the benefit of breast milk as a culinary ingredient for us grown ups? The owner of a Swiss restaurant wants to include in his menu dishes (such as stews and sauces) that include about 75%  of mother’s milk. "We have all been raised on it. Why should we not include it into our diet?" Hans Locher the owner stated and continued to say  "I first experimented with breast milk when my daughter was born. "One can cook really delicious things with it. However, it always needs to be mixed with a bit of whipped cream, in order to keep the consistency."

He garnered attention for his plan of including human breast milk at his eatery from an ad he posted trying to find lactating women to sell him their milk. This of course got the attention of the Swiss government but there seems to be a gray area. You can’t use apes and primates as they are “banned species” but there isn’t anything on the books about not using human milk commercially.

(source and image from the Telegraph)
